How is Section 8 different from public housing?

Section 8 Housing: Flexibility and Choice

Section 8, or the Housing Choice Voucher Program, is managed by local Public Housing Authorities (PHAs) under the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D). This program provides vouchers to help eligible participants cover rent in privately-owned properties. Here's a breakdown of how Section 8 works:

  • Voucher System: Participants receive vouchers that cover a portion of their rent, which is paid directly to the landlord by the PHA. Tenants are responsible for paying the remainder, usually around 30% of their income.
  • Location Flexibility: Section 8 vouchers allow you to choose rental homes in various neighborhoods, offering a broader range of living environments.
  • Variety of Housing Options: Vouchers can be used for different types of housing, such as single-family homes and apartments, giving you more choices to fit your lifestyle.

While Section 8 offers many benefits, it does have challenges. High demand and limited funding can result in long waiting lists. Additionally, not all landlords accept Section 8 vouchers, so finding suitable housing may require extra effort.

Public Housing: Stability and Community

Public housing consists of government-owned units managed by local PHAs, designed to offer affordable rental options for low-income individuals and families. Here’s what you need to know about public housing:

  • Fixed Locations: Public housing units are located in specific areas managed by the PHA, often fostering a sense of community among residents.
  • Affordable Rent: Rent is generally capped at 30% of your income, ensuring it remains affordable. Public housing offers fixed rents compared to the more flexible arrangements in Section 8.
  • Stable Housing: Public housing provides a stable living situation, particularly beneficial for families and individuals facing housing instability.

While public housing offers these advantages, it also has some limitations. Availability can be limited, and the application process may be lengthy. Additionally, public housing often comes with stricter rules and regulations compared to private rental options available through Section 8.

Choosing the Right Option for You

Understanding the differences between Section 8 and public housing is crucial for finding the right affordable housing solution. If you value flexibility and the ability to choose your housing, Section 8 may be the better fit. However, if you prefer a community-oriented environment and are comfortable with designated units, public housing could be the ideal choice.

Both programs aim to help low-income individuals and families achieve stable housing. By researching and understanding these options, you can make an informed decision that aligns with your financial situation and lifestyle preferences.
